Latest Patents

One of Okouchi's latest patents involves a driving tool that includes a driver designed to move linearly along a driving line. This innovative design allows the tool to strike and drive a fastener into a workpiece effectively. The driver consists of a striking member, a support member, and an engagement member that restricts the movement of the striking member relative to the support member. The support member features a support surface that supports part of the striking member and includes receiving surfaces to handle reaction forces during the driving process. Another patent describes a driving tool where a restriction member is retained in an on-position by a cam. This design ensures that an electric motor remains activated even after the trigger is released, allowing the driver to return to a standby position seamlessly.
